Cost of living in Kehl is 38% higher than in Klaipeda (without rent).
Rent in Kehl is 86% more expensive than in Klaipeda.
Cost of living including rent in Kehl is 60% higher than in Klaipeda.
Food in Kehl is 32% more expensive than in Klaipeda.
Transport in Kehl is 113% more expensive than in Klaipeda.
